In
this module you will complete two of five tasks necessary to achieve
the objectives of production-time-series analysis. These objectives
are to determine the initial reservoir drive mechanism of a reservoir,
understand the effects of previous reservoir production strategies,
and understand how the reservoir architecture has influenced fluid
flow. The two tasks are:
- Analyzing
initial and spatial time variation of fluid chemistry
- Analyzing
initial conditions for fluid contacts from completion, workover,
logs, and pressure.
Module 13 covers the last three tasks, which
are graphing production and annotating with production strategy history,
mapping and analyzing time-series history of fluid production, and
determining the flow direction of injected and encroaching fluids.
